Starz' 'Spartacus' To End Next Season

Starz' series "Spartacus" will end next season, its creator Steven S. DeKnight tells Entertainment Weekly, adding that the final season will be its most spectacular:

"This season is bigger than anything we've attempted. The scope and scale is just amazing. We're dealing with massive battles between thousands of people. We hope to leave people feel satisfied."

". . . in the end, the story was best served by rolling all of the remaining action and drama of Spartacus' journey into one stunningly epic season that will be extremely satisfying for everyone who's been along for the ride," he added.

The last season "Spartacus Vengeance," averaged over 6 million viewers per week. Its third and final season, "Spartacus: War of the Damned," is currently in production in New Zealand.

It is comprised of 10 episodes which are set to air in January.
